Understanding Biodiversity and Its Role
Biodiversity is the variety of life found on Earth, encompassing all living organisms, their interactions, and the ecosystems they form. A rich biodiversity ensures natural sustainability for all life forms. It provides us with essential services, including clean air, water purification, and fertile soil. The decline of biodiversity can lead to ecosystem collapse, which can have dire consequences for human health and wellbeing.

The Ecological Importance of Species Like the Rhinoceros
The rhinoceros is not just an iconic species; it plays a crucial role in its ecosystem. As a herbivore, it contributes to the maintenance of the grasslands and forests where it resides. By grazing on certain plants, it helps to control vegetation growth, which in turn supports a variety of other species. The loss of such a keystone species can lead to detrimental changes in the ecosystem, highlighting the importance of wildlife conservation efforts.
